1996 PLC 85

IJAZ HUSSAIN SHAH vs LIAQAT HUSSAIN and 11 Others

Citation1996 PLC 85
CourtNational Industrial Relations Commission
Case No.Case No, 4(12) of 1994
Date1995-01-22
Judge(s)Gohar Yaqoob Yousafzai
ResultComplaint dismissed.

ORDER

' This is a complaint filed under section 53 read with sections 15 and 16 of the S.R.O., 1969 against 12 respondents including the office-bearers of H.M.C. Awami Labour Union, Taxila and four Managers of the Establishment. The notices were served upon the respondents who have appeared in person and have also filed their comments through their counsel.

2. I have heard the learned counsel for the parties and with their help has perused the record of the case. Before holding inquiry into the merits of the case I consider it proper to first deal with the legal objections as to the maintainability of the complaint, raised by the learned counsel for the respondent/accused.

3. The complaint is mainly based upon the allegation of unfair labour practice, allegedly committed by the respondents on 4-12-1993, as narrated in para. No,4 of the complaint, while the instant complaint is filed on 4-7-1994, i,e, after a delay of about 10 months. Such a long delay in the filing of this complaint is totally unexplained. The appellant has not uttered a single word in the complaint nor in the supporting documents. If there is no justified explanation to such delay, not only it creates doubts, the benefit of which goes to the accused, but also, the very complaint itself becomes doubtful and unreliable, especially in the circumstances where admittedly litigation in the other Courts were also pending between the parties. Support can be obtained from the case law reported in PLC 1963 Labour 58 and 1968 PCr.LJ 392. The arguments that because it is not a civil case, therefore, no limitation is provided for it is misleading. It is not the provisions of the Limitation Act under which such delay becomes fatal but is a basic and well-settled principle of criminal law.

Therefore, in .My view this complaint, being not tendering any plausible or justified explanation of such delay, is not maintainable and is, therefore, dismissed without, any' further proceedings.
